Final answer:
The value of y, when x is -7, is 10.
Step-by-step explanation:
The absolute value of a number is its distance from zero on a number line. When given a value for x, to find the value of |x| we simply take the positive version of that value. So if x = -7, then |x| = 7.
Next, we add 3 to the absolute value of x. In this case, y = |x| + 3 = 7 + 3 = 10.
Therefore, if x is -7, then y is 10.
